What is a Dental Check Up?

A dental check up is a professional examination of your teeth, gums, and mouth. A dentist checks for cavities, gum disease, and other oral health issues. Many check ups also include a cleaning and X-rays to get a full picture of your dental health.

  • Early detection: Catch problems like cavities or gum disease before they get worse.
  • Professional cleaning: Remove plaque and tartar that regular brushing misses.
  • Peace of mind: Know the current state of your oral health with a full report.

Types of Dental Check Ups Offered in Korea

  • Basic Exam: A visual check of your teeth and gums. Often includes a simple cleaning. Best for patients with no major concerns.
  • Full Oral Exam with X-rays: Includes digital X-rays to check bone levels, roots, and hidden cavities. This is the most common option for new patients.
  • Panoramic X-ray Exam: A wide-angle X-ray that shows all your teeth, jaw, and sinuses in one image. Useful before orthodontic or implant treatment.
  • Comprehensive Dental Assessment: A detailed exam that covers teeth, gums, bite alignment, and oral cancer screening. Recommended for medical tourists planning further dental work.

Cost of a Dental Check Up in Korea

  • Basic Exam (no X-rays): ₩30,000 – ₩50,000 (approximately $22 – $37 USD)
  • Full Exam with Digital X-rays: ₩80,000 – ₩150,000 (approximately $60 – $112 USD)
  • Panoramic X-ray + Exam: ₩100,000 – ₩180,000 (approximately $75 – $135 USD)
  • Comprehensive Assessment + Cleaning: ₩200,000 – ₩350,000 (approximately $150 – $260 USD)

These prices are general estimates. Final costs depend on the clinic location, added services, and any follow-up treatments recommended.

What to Expect During and After

Your dental check up in Korea is usually quick and comfortable. Most appointments last between 30 and 60 minutes. The dentist will examine your mouth, take X-rays if needed, and explain any findings clearly. If a cleaning is included, a hygienist will remove plaque and polish your teeth. After the appointment, you will receive a full report. Your gums may feel slightly sensitive after a cleaning, but this fades within a day or two. There is no downtime, and you can eat and drink normally right after.

Follow-up and Results

After your check up, the dentist will discuss any issues found and recommend next steps. If you are planning further dental work such as fillings, whitening, or implants, your check up results will guide the treatment plan.
